Highlights Inside the Palace
Geunjeongjeon (Throne Hall) – where official state ceremonies were held.
Gyeonghoeru Pavilion – sits on a lotus pond; used for royal banquets.
Hyangwonjeong Pavilion – a small, beautiful island pavilion in the rear garden.
Sajeongjeon Hall – King’s executive office.
Opening Hours
Typically: 9:00 AM – 6:00 PM (last admission ~1 hour before closing)
Closed: Tuesdays
Ticket Info
Adults: ~₩3,000
Free: Hanbok wearers, seniors, and children (conditions apply)
How to Get There
Subway:
Gyeongbokgung Station (Line 3, Exit 5) – directly in front of the palace
Gwanghwamun Station (Line 5, Exit 2) – short walk away
